'''Talgat Amangeldyuly Musabayev''' ({{lang-kk|Талғат Аманкелдіұлы Мұсабаев}}; born 7 January 1951&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io&amp;gt;{{cite web|url=http://www.spacefacts.de/bios/cosmonauts/english/musabayev_talgat.htm|title=Cosmonaut Biography: Talgat Musabayev|publisher=spacefacts.de}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;) is a [[Kazakhstan|Kazakh]] test pilot and former [[astronaut|cosmonaut]] who flew on three [[spaceflight]]s. His first two spaceflights were long-duration stays aboard the Russian [[space station]] ''[[Mir]]''. His third spaceflight was a short duration visiting mission to the [[International Space Station]], which also carried the first paying [[space tourism|space tourist]] [[Dennis Tito]]. He retired as a cosmonaut in November 2003.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t; Since 2007 he has been head of Kazakhstan's National Space Agency, [[KazCosmos]].&lt;br /&gt;

==Early career==&lt;br /&gt;
Musabayev graduated from Engineering Institute of Civil Aviation in [[Riga]] in 1974.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t; Then in 1983 he graduated from Higher Military Aviation School in [[Akhtubinsk]], with an engineering diploma.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t; Musabayev received several awards as an aerobatic flyer and was selected as a cosmonaut on 11 May 1990. In 1991, he was appointed to Major and transferred to the cosmonaut group of Air Force (TsPK-11).&amp;lt;ref name=NASA-bio/&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Cosmonaut career==&lt;br /&gt;
Musabayev was selected to be a cosmonaut on 11 May 1990.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Mir EO-16===&lt;br /&gt;
His first spaceflight was as a crew member of the long-duration mission [[Mir EO-16]], which was launched and landed by the spacecraft [[Soyuz TM-19]]. Musabayev was designated Flight Engineer; the mission lasted from 1 July 1994 to 4 November 1994, for a total duration of 125 days 22 hours 53 minutes.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Mir EO-25===&lt;br /&gt;
His second spaceflight was as Commander of another long-duration expedition called [[Mir EO-25]], which was launched by the spacecraft [[Soyuz TM-27]]. The mission lasted from 29 January 1998 to 25 August 25, 1998, for a total duration of 207 days 12 hours 49 minutes.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===ISS EP-1===&lt;br /&gt;
His third mission was as Commander of [[ISS EP-1]], which was a visiting mission to the [[International Space Station]]. It was launched by [[Soyuz TM-32]], and was landed by [[Soyuz TM-31]] on 6 May 2001, for a total duration of 7 days 22 hours 4 minutes.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t; This visiting mission was notable for carrying the first ever paying [[space tourism|space tourist]] [[Dennis Tito]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
{{As of|2007}}, he was among the [[Spaceflight records#Total time in space|top 30 cosmonauts by time in space]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Later life==&lt;br /&gt;
He retired from being a cosmonaut in November 2003.&amp;lt;ref name=SF-bio/&amp;gt; He became deputy head of the [[Soviet military academies#Zhukovsky Air Force Engineering Academy|Zhukovsky Air Force Engineering Academy]] and was appointed to Major General in September 2003. From 2005 to 2007 he was General Director of &amp;quot;Bayterek&amp;quot; Corp. which was a Kazakhstani-Russian Joint Venture.&amp;lt;ref name=KZ-bio&amp;gt;{{cite web|url=http://primeminister.government.kz/blogs/musabaev_t?lang=en|title=Biography|publisher= Kazakhstan government website}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
11 April 2007, Musabayev was appointed Head of the National Space Agency of the Republic of Kazakhstan, also known as [[KazCosmos]].&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{cite web|url=http://www.inform.kz/eng/article/2178551|title=Kazakhstan has own space exploration course :Talgat Musabayev|publisher=Kazinform|date=13 April 2009}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
